The Dock Brief - Review<br />
The Dock Brief is a play written by John Mortimer, which is Produced and<br />
Directed by Michael Hasted. Alan "Tweedy" Digweed who is best known as<br />
a contemporary clown with Giffords Circus plays Fowle the defendant, he<br />
shares the Everyman stage with Mark Hyde who plays Morganhall the<br />
knarled aging barrister looking for a lucky break.<br />
So the stage is set in the intimate Everyman Studio in Cheltenham with the<br />
whole play taking place in a prison cell. Fowle is accused of murdering his<br />
wife and Morganhall the barrister after years of waiting for his first Dock<br />
Brief is to defend him. What is really engaging is that there are only the two<br />
actors on the stage which is rare in itself and both Tweedy and Mark Hyde<br />
really work the audience.<br />
